Credo

credo

Added on August 8, 2014 by Matthew Sutton.

From the important twentieth-century Catholic theologian, Hans Urs von Balthasar (1905-1988), this book offers a deep meditation on the Apostle’s Creed, which is the simplest and most central statement of Christian belief. Understanding the theological meaning of this creed will unlock so much knowledge for you in order to understand Christianity.

“‘I believe in God the Father Almighty, Creator of heaven and earth’ — That he is Father we know in utmost fullness from Jesus Christ, who constantly makes loving, thankful, and reverent reference to him as his Origin.” (p. 30)

Hans Urs von Balthasar. Credo: Meditations on the Apostle’s Creed. Ignatius Press. 2000. ISBN: 9780898708035. Paperback. Kindle.
